Postby Down the Hill » Mon Jul 03, 2023 12:47 pm

Trying to clean up the league? I think they have absolutely achieved cleaning up the league and are maintaining that by sending out a strong message with the length of suspensions for what has become a small number of reportable offences each week when you consider how many games are played across the league. It's actually a pleasure to watch a game of AdFL footy without some of the macho BS that players used to engage in and still do in some other leagues.

It was the old push and shove and other little cheap shots that would lead to more serious incidents as the game went on. Whilst I still get a little frustrated with how liberal some of the umps are with dishing out yellow cards you can see how effective this can be in putting a stop to something that could escalate later in the game. Massive improvement in spectator behaviour has also helped with a greater sense of calm out on the field.
